PTSD Treatment: Restoring Confidence and Trust
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D) can be a debilitating condition, but with the right treatment, individuals can regain their sense of confidence and trust. PTSD treatment often involves a combination of psychotherapy and medication. Therapies like EMDR (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ing) and cognitive-behavioral therapy have proven particularly effective in helping individuals process and overcome the trauma that triggers their symptoms.

Insomnia Solutions: Better Sleep Through Therapy
Insomnia can severely impact an individual’s quality of life, but therapy offers various solutions to better sleep. Cognitive-behavioral therapy for insomnia (CBT-I) is a common approach that helps individuals modify the thoughts and behaviors that disrupt sleep. This therapeutic intervention not only improves sleep quality but also enhances overall well-being.

Managing OCD: OCD Help for Adults and Kids
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der (OCD) can be a challenging condition to manage, but with specialized help for both adults and children, significant progress can be made. Treatment often involves a combination of psychotherapy and medication, with techniques such as Exposure and Response Prevention (ERP) being particularly effective in reducing compulsive behaviors and obsessive thoughts.

Autism Support: Transition Planning for Teens with ASD
For teens with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D), transition planning is crucial as they move into adulthood. This support focuses on developing life skills, educational goals, and employment opportunities that align with their strengths and interests. By providing tailored support during this critical period, professionals can help individuals with ASD achieve a higher quality of life and greater independence.
